Supported Living For Adults With Learning Disabilities, Autism And Complex Care Needs

Supported living is a unique approach to care that enables individuals with disabilities or complex needs to live independently within their homes or in community-based settings. This person-centred model of care promotes autonomy, choice and active participation in everyday life, fostering a sense of belonging and community integration.

Independent living

You could choose to live independently in your own flat with as much or as little support as you need. This could be in one of our already established properties, or we can work with you and our housing partners to source a property that meets your needs.

Shared living

We can help connect you with other people who might want to live independently too but aren’t yet ready to live alone. You will have your own space but benefit from socialising with other like-minded people, sharing the communal spaces and sharing the costs of household bills.

Apartment living

You may be looking for the best of both worlds. Your own modern apartment with some shared communal space. That way you can choose when and if you want to socialise. We have worked with our housing partners to develop this popular type of accommodation.

Stepping-stone accommodation

TThis provides stability whilst you are between long-term support solutions. This type of support will help you plan for your future in a structured way. We will support you with the skills you may need to help you live more independently and, when you are ready, support you to move on.
